Job Summary:

We are seeking a reliable and detail-oriented Porter to join our dealership team. As a Porter, you will play a vital role in supporting both the service and sales departments. This includes maintaining dealership organization, handling vehicle logistics, and assisting with inventory management—all while providing excellent customer service.

Key Responsibilities:
Service Department:
  • Greet customers and assist with vehicle drop-off and pick-up.
  • Move vehicles to and from service bays, parking areas, and the lot.
  • Keep the service drive, shop areas, and customer waiting areas clean and organized.
  • Assist with light vehicle washing and interior/exterior cleaning as needed.
  • Support technicians and service advisors with vehicle-related tasks.
Sales Department:
  • Check in and inspect new and pre-owned vehicles delivered by transport companies.
  • Stock in vehicles into the dealership inventory system, including verifying VINs and affixing stock tags.
  • Manage and organize vehicle keys for sales staff and management.
  • Move vehicles as needed for display, photography, detailing, or delivery.
  • Assist in the flow of vehicles through the used car reconditioning process
    , including transporting cars to/from detail, inspection, or photo staging areas.
  • Keep the sales lot clean, organized, and optimized for customer viewing
Qualifications:
  • Valid driver’s license and clean driving record.
  • Ability to operate both manual and automatic transmissions.
  • Dependable, self-motivated, and professional demeanor.
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to follow procedures accurately.
  • Able to work outdoors in various weather conditions and be on your feet for extended periods.
  • Prior experience at an automotive dealership or in a similar role is a plus.
